Upon finding this place, we were eager to try it due to the unique menu of food and drinks they offer and we LOVE to support our local small businesses and make friends along the way. Both my husband and I's sandwiches were delicious as well as our London Fog Latte, however I would feel deterred to go out of my way to go again because our overall experience was tainted by the staff.

Having never been there before, as we approached we saw a young woman serving food to a couple on the patio and sat at an open table nearby. The staff member walked passed us on four seperate occasions without greeting/acknowledging us whatsoever. You could see how this would cause confusion. I went inside to ask about ordering and learned it is order at the counter. Now, order at the counter is totally fine. In fact, one of our favorite spots operates that way. The difference here was staff saw us sitting for a prolonged time in the heat looking around and did not care to say hello, or welcome, or ask us if we've been before. A simple "hello! sit wherever you'd like and come inside to order when you're ready!" Would have not only been appreciated, polite, good business, but it's just standard. When I went in to ask, I was not even greeted, no smile, just my order taken. I politely told her hello and that it was our first time and we did not know we needed to come in to order to which they ignored and did not acknowledge. After placing my order I was told I could wait for my beverage inside and I did so happily. When it came out no one directed me to where I could find a lid, or a straw, and when I asked they simply pointed with a short reply- Monotone. Now, these are all very small things that can make or break an experience at an establishment, especially one this small. Maybe a "place order inside" sign could be useful if the staff will not be communicating with guests. This all just baffled me because it was very slow when we arrived with only 2 other couples seated and roughly 3-4 staff members up front and walking by. Customer service is a huge part of the food industry, whether walk up or dining. This was a pitty because the menu and establishment have much potential. I have worked in the service industry for many years from small cafés, busy night bars, to private yachts and this would have not been acceptable behavior at any. I must note that the young man working the delivered our sanwich was the only friendly one kindly asking if there was anything else we needed. Credit where...

Came to Bonita Springs for a little vacation with my husband I do a little research before going places and seen this place on Tik Tok. Little shack type with AMAZING food and AMAZING coffee and wine. I ordered the mimosa and my husband ordered one of the macchiato’s they were both really good. Food I ordered the prosciutto sandwich and my husband ordered the everything bagel with smoked salmon. Service was a tad long for the coffee but with how good everything tasted it was well worth the wait. All outdoor seating but they had lots of fans around to cool people off and a small little nook inside if you can’t sit outside. Dog friendly amazing atmosphere. The next time I come with will be the first place I go.

Downtown Coffee and Wine Company in Bonita Springs, FL. Sunday morning coffee should look like this 🫶🏼. @downtowncoffeebonita specializes in my two favorite things: coffee and wine! Their coffee beans are roasted locally in southwest Florida and are grinded and brewed fresh to order. It’s such a unique menu featuring both coffee and wine! The service was amazing! It’s such a cute place and perfect stop for a pick me up or a place to relax. Insta: @thehungrysw 🌀Tiramisu Latte w/ Lady Fingers + Cocoa 🌀Horchata Latte w/ Cinnamon + Cane Sugar + Rice Milk
